No matter who we are, we all have to die one day.
When we die, the question is what will be written on our tombstone.
Will it be something that transformed someone's life, or will it be just a birth date and the death date with people who are survived after us.
I asked this question to almost 300+ people from all walks of life and the answer I received was enlightening.
None of them talked about their career or hobbies. Each of the answers had one thing in common: they had a desire to contribute to someone's life.

Then I asked another question: If you got a chance to re-design your life, what would you do differently?
Again the answer amazed me. Here are a few snapshots.
If you observe, most of us don't follow our passion because of the fear of failing we carry in life.
Then the obvious next question was the origin of the fear and the validity of it at present.
Here are a few snapshots.
66% found that the fear was baseless, 18% didn't verify the fear, and 3% didn't want to confess the truth. That means 87% of people's fear was baseless.
